On Permutation Procedures for Strong Control in Multiple Testing with Gene Expression Data
We consider two popular, permutation-based, step-down procedures of p-values adjustment in multiple testing problems known as min P and max T and intended for strong control of the family-wise error rate, under the so-called subset pivotality property (SPP).
